Design thinking is a human-centered approach to product engineering that emphasizes empathy, collaboration, and iteration. This methodology involves understanding the needs of users and stakeholders, generating creative solutions, and testing and refining those solutions through rapid prototyping and feedback. In this article, we will explore what design thinking is, its purpose, methods, and techniques.
Design thinking in product engineering is designing and creating products that prioritize the user’s needs. It involves using empathy and collaboration to understand the user’s needs, generate a wide range of potential solutions, and test and refine them through rapid prototyping and feedback. This approach focuses on creating more intuitive, engaging, and effective products and is used by product engineers to develop products that meet the needs of their customers.
The purpose of design thinking in product engineering is to create products that are better aligned with the needs and desires of the end user. This approach emphasizes the human-centered design process, which involves gaining empathy and understanding the needs and behaviors of users. Design thinking aims to generate creative solutions and test those solutions through rapid prototyping and feedback to refine and improve the product. By using design thinking, product engineers can create products that are more intuitive, user-friendly, and more likely to meet the intended audience’s needs. This can lead to better user adoption, customer satisfaction, and business success.
